Mike Ness is an American punk rock musician, singer, songwriter, and guitarist, best known as the frontman of the legendary band Social Distortion. Ness is also a custom car enthusiast and founding member of the Lonely Kings Car Club.


Born in 1962, Ness was raised in Fullerton, California. He was exposed to country, rock 'n' roll, and punk rock at an early age. He formed Social Distortion in 1978 and released their debut album in 1983. Throughout the band's career, he has released 10 studio albums with Social Distortion, and two solo albums. His solo albums, Cheating at Solitaire and Under the Influences, have been critically acclaimed and highlighted Ness's influences from various genres. In addition to his work with Social Distortion, Ness has appeared on numerous compilations, contributed to movie soundtracks, and collaborated with other artists.
